Are Mario and Luigi Brothers or Cousins?
The Mario brothers, Mario and Luigi, are one of the most iconic and beloved duos in the world of video games. Created by the legendary Japanese video game designer Shigeru Miyamoto, the brothers have been the protagonists of numerous games, TV shows, and movies. But one question has always been on the minds of fans: are Mario and Luigi brothers or cousins?
Direct Answer:
According to various sources, including official Nintendo statements and interviews with Miyamoto himself, Mario and Luigi are brothers. They were born on the same day, as seen in Super Mario World 2: Yoshi’s Island and Yoshi’s New Island, and have always been associated together as siblings.
